WebBeta particles are high-energy, high-speed electrons or positrons emitted by certain fission fragments or certain primordial radioactive nuclei such as potassium-40. The beta particles are a form of ionizing radiation, also known as beta rays. The production of beta particles is termed beta decay. Low-energy gammas, bordering on the x-ray region, are relatively non-penetrating, but higher-energy gammas will typically pass through a fairly large amount of matter without … WebSep 22, 2024 · The α-particle has the least penetrating power since it is the largest and slowest emission. It can be blocked by a sheet of paper or a human hand. Beta particles are more penetrating than alpha particles, but can be stopped by a thin sheet of aluminum.

WebSince gamma radiation has the highest penetrating and lowest ionising power, it has unique applications. Gamma rays are used to detect leaks in pipework. Similar to PET scanners (where gamma-emitting sources are also used), radioisotopic tracers (radioactive or unstable decaying isotopes) are able to map leaks and damaged areas of pipework.
